Crystal structure of Mycobacterium tuberculosis phosphatidylinositol phosphate synthase (PgsA1) with CDP-DAG bound Descriptor: (2S)-2,3-dihydroxypropyl (9Z)-octadec-9-enoate, CDP-diacylglycerol--inositol 3-phosphatidyltransferase, MAGNESIUM ION, ... Authors: Grave, K, Hogbom, M. Deposit date: 2018-07-24 Release date: 2019-05-15 Last modified: 2024-01-17 Method: X-RAY DIFFRACTION (1.8 Å) Cite: Structure ofMycobacterium tuberculosisphosphatidylinositol phosphate synthase reveals mechanism of substrate binding and metal catalysis. Commun Biol, 2, 2019
